Undergraduate Visual & Performing Arts Degrees at WKCTC

The table below lists every degree level offered in visual & performing arts at WKCTC, along with how many graduates complete each level annually.

Degree Level Annual Graduates
Associate’s 4
Certificate 7

WKCTC Undergraduate Tuition and Fees

$4,728 Average Tuition and Fees (In-State)

Information about average full-time undergraduate tuition and fees is shown in the table below.

In State Out of State
Tuition $4,296 $6,240
Fees $192 $192
